Transaction 65de49235023e330e70734c94b74055e7bce43e573aa804c31199ddf1c1598a8
1 Input
1 Output
-
65de49235023e330e70734c94b74055e7bce43e573aa804c31199ddf1c1598a8:0
- value
- 24843608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5c5b04efd80dfd78ab2c048cb53dfe9e3018483 OP_EQUAL
- address
- 3Q6YJCDih6uttWYFYkMUKWwb2JoV33ZY67